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4369 85 20758592757 173
6061108555 887924279 858
6061108555 887924279 858
39300028856 16885575 26
All about undefined
Interested in learning more?
6061108555 887924279 858
39300028856 16885575 26
See more
467172026 2943007 8506803535
66504247 702436175 49
See more
090 651461
9440954952 86647116 0864150
See more